WHAT'S HAPPENING
Math: This week we wrote a LOT of number sentences! We are working on thinking addition when subtracting and recognizing related facts.
Reader's Workshop: This week we began a favorite in Reader's Workshop: Reading Non-Fiction! We reviewed how to determine if a book is non-fiction and began learning about text features. We also booked shopped to make sure we all have 3 non-fiction books to practice our non-fiction reading with. Today we focused on bold words and using a glossary.
Writer's Workshop: This week we continued our collection writing. We looked at exemplar writings to notice what those writers were doing well. Most of us finished writing about our own collections and we have began reviewing one another's collections.
Science/Social Studies: This week we began our economics unit in Social Studies. We discuss the difference between needs and wants. We also began talking about goods and services.
